Several parliamentary committees of the Assembly of Kosovo will hold meetings today to define and approve their areas of activity for the current mandate.

At 10:00, the Committee on Public Administration, Digitalization, Local Government, Media and Regional Development will review the drafting of its work plan. At the same time, the Committee on Education, Science and Technology will also meet to approve its scope of responsibilities.

At 11:00, the Committee on Economy, Industry, Entrepreneurship, Trade and Innovation is scheduled to review and approve its operational agenda.

Later in the day, at 13:00, the Special Committee for Managing the Selection Process of Non-Prosecutor Members of the Prosecutorial Council will discuss announcing a public call for the selection of a non-prosecutor member of the Kosovo Prosecutorial Council.

These meetings mark an important step as parliamentary committees set priorities and organize their work for the legislative period ahead.
